Description
1 Penny from Kingdom of Wessex. Issued from 871 to 875. Struck in Silver. Measures 19 mm and weighs 1.32 g.
- Obverse
- Diademed Mercian style bust right, royal title around. (King Alfred.)
- Reverse
- Moneyer's name between lunettes above and below. (Wine, moneyer.)
